Last night I came home from work, and Joshua, our five year old, immediately started whining. He wanted his friend Kaleb to come over. I said, “let’s wait ‘til after supper and then we’ll see”. Evidently, that answer was not the one he wanted because from that point on, literally every five minutes Josh would ask, “did you decide yet? Can Kaleb come over?” voiced with A LOT of “whine”.
So having stored in my memory bank a conversation that I had overheard Josh having with a friend of his once, a conversation where Josh said something to this effect, “I whine until I get my way.” I said to him, “if you whine about this one more time, then the answer is no.” Yeah you guessed it, five minutes later I said “no”. Which in turn was cause for more whining.
He was about to drive me (and the rest of the household) nuts, so I thought I’d try to get his mind off of it by saying, “let’s all go in town and go for a walk”. The boys, Josh and Will, did not want to go, and I thought “that’s even better”, so we left them at home.
So, Denny, Maren, Merle (my mom) and I all went in town to go for a walk. We parked our van and had walked about five blocks when my cell phone rang. It was Will, who says with much distress, “MOM, Josh shoved a reeses pieces up his nose and we can’t get it out. I could hear Joshua both screaming and gagging in the background. I told Will to have him blow his nose, and it still didn’t come out. So Denny ran back to get the van to go home, while I commenced having a conversation with Joshua. I said, “Josh, can you breathe okay?” and he could. So I said, “don’t cry, don’t gag. Your dad’s on his way home, just be still” and he calmed down. Then I said “Josh, how did you get a reeses pieces up your nose?” to which he replied, “it was an accident.” I thought to myself, “what, like you threw one up in the air and tried to catch it in your mouth, and it went down your nose hole instead?”
In the meantime, I had told Will to go get his Aunt Darla who lives next door, while I stayed on the phone with Josh. While I was still on the phone, and before Denny got home, Darla got to Josh and had him cover the clean nostril and blow out the other side, and the reeses pieces came out quite nicely into Darla’s hand…YUK!!
In hindsight, I’m thinking the evening would have gone a lot smoother had we just called Kaleb in the beginning and had him come over!
